Cortisol and Testosterone Balance

Meaning

Cortisol is a primary stress hormone originating from the adrenal glands. Testosterone is a principal sex hormone, synthesized in the gonads and adrenal glands. Their balance refers to their optimal relative concentrations and dynamic interactions within the physiological systems of the human body. An appropriate ratio between these two steroid hormones is crucial for maintaining systemic physiological function and overall well-being.
